色婷婷狠狠18禁久久YY,CHINESE性内射高清国产,国产女人18毛片水真多1,国产AV在线观看

CSS中動畫和效果

李中冰1年前8瀏覽0評論

CSS是一種用于控制網頁樣式的語言,其中包含了很多有趣的動畫和效果。在這篇文章中,我們將介紹一些常見的CSS動畫和效果。

/* 使用CSS實現動畫 */
/* 1. transition過渡效果 */
/* 使用transition可以讓元素在狀態改變時平滑地過渡 */
.box {
background-color: red;
transition: background-color 1s;
}
.box:hover {
background-color: blue;
}
/* 2. transform動畫 */
/* 使用transform可以以更加自然的方式動態改變元素的形狀和位置 */
.box {
transform: scale(1);
transition: transform 1s;
}
.box:hover {
transform: scale(1.5);
}
/* 3. animation動畫 */
/* 使用animation可以創建更加復雜和有趣的動畫效果 */
.box {
animation: myanimation 1s infinite;
}
@keyframes myanimation {
0% {
transform: scale(1);
}
50% {
transform: scale(2);
}
100% {
transform: scale(1);
}
}
/* CSS實現效果 */
/* 1. 漸變背景色 */
/* 使用linear-gradient可以創建從一個顏色到另一個顏色的漸變 */
.box {
background: linear-gradient(red, blue);
}
/* 2. 陰影效果 */
/* 使用box-shadow可以創建元素的陰影效果 */
.box {
box-shadow: 5px 5px 5px grey;
}
/* 3. 邊框動畫 */
/* 使用border-image和animation可以創建一個有趣的邊框動畫 */
.box {
border: 5px solid transparent;
border-image: linear-gradient(to bottom, red, blue) 1 100%;
animation: borderanimation 2s infinite alternate;
}
@keyframes borderanimation {
0% {
border-image-slice: 1 0;
}
100% {
border-image-slice: 0 1;
}
}

以上就是一些常見的CSS動畫和效果的實現方法。有了這些技巧,你可以在設計網頁時創造出更加生動有趣的效果。